Make-believe
by
Amethyst

you made me hollyhock dolls
and sang to me
and we played pretend
and I didn't understand
why
I couldn't live at your house

then
I learned that auntie
meant you weremoon butterfly
my mom's sister

(how could that be?
I trusted you)

so
you had to take me home

and you couldn't listen
to things I had to tell

and everything would be fine
if it remained unspoken

I came to your door
quiet
and quieter
and you said,
"Let's make sugar cookies."

We rolled the dough
tossed flour at each other
cut out shapes
of roosters, rabbits, stars
you sang off key
in different voices
and did things that were
a little bit crazy

filled me up with cookies
and laughter
and love enough

to face going back

my best friend
in a game without words
lip-reading my heart
